If you have 4 slots (with that cpu), then you have 2 slots for each memory channel. The slots will be mapped either ABAB or AABB. Obviously you want each channel to have as much memory as the other so that the memory can be interleaved properly for maximum performance. But I don't have a manual for your motherboard to indicate what the slot mapping is.

You were talking about getting a matched 4 GB module and using that along with your 8 GB module. Two of my suggestions are for just the 4 GB sticks, and the other two are for adding in an 8 GB stick. It's possible adding the 8 GB stick may lower performance (due to there possibly being fewer memory ranks on the stick), so that's why I also suggest benchmarking with and without it :)

Found this in the user guide:

Code:
10 DIMM4 (Channel A) DIMM4 white Memory Module
11 DIMM3 (Channel A) DIMM3 black Memory Module
12 DIMM2 (Channel B) DIMM2 white Memory Module
13 DIMM1 (Channel B) DIMM1 black Memory Module
I'm thinking there might be a preference to use DIMM1 first so might I put from top to bottom: x-8 4-4 ??

Or does it not matter as long as A and B each have same 8GB?
Did so....got second i5-3570 working.
I did a benchmark and compared the times of the first new i5-3570 with 4x2GB of stock RAM to this new one with 2x4GB + 1x8GB that I added. The Benchmark times show that the stock PC is about 1% faster. I can live with that. I think it indicates the Dual Channel is working in the second new PC.
